Abstract
The IR spectra of anthracene-h(10) and -d(10) have been recorded for t he first time in the gas phase from 450 to 3200 cm(-1) with a resoluti on of 0.2 cm(-1), using a multipass cell heated to 100 degrees C. For the assignment of vibrational bands we have evaluated the theoretical spectrum using density functional theory (DFT) and scaled self consist ent held force fields. We found that both methods reproduce the sequen ce of the experimental frequencies to a good accuracy, allowing in mos t cases consistent and unambiguous assignments. The relative intensiti es of C14H10 and C14D10 have also been measured and compared to theory . (C) 1997 American Institute of Physics.
